I was wondering why world leaders wore the same shirts at the APEC meetings. It seems that President Clinton started the tradition.

Good Pictures at this link. Pictures in below link also.

Awkward Apec fashion: what world leaders wore – in pictures

Quote from bottom link: "World leaders have Bill Clinton to thank for starting the annual tradition back in 1993, when he hosted the summit in Seattle and gifted world leaders in attendance with matching bomber jackets."

"The next year, the tables turned on Clinton and it was his turn to don a traditional Indonesian shirt selected by the summit's subsequent host country."

"President Barack Obama made no secret of the fact that he wasn't such a fan of the tradition with his decision to nix it when it was his turn to host the APEC summit on his home turf of Hawaii in 2011, after previously threatening in jest that he would make world leaders wear aloha shirts or grass skirts."

*Subject:**WH Travel Pool Report #2*

The opening ceremony is being held in a cavernous auditorium with a stage flanked by the flags of the ASEAN member countries.
At 943, as an orchestra played a stately processional, the leaders filed into the auditorium and took white leather seats facing the stage.
Trump greeted PM Malcom Turnbull and PM Justin Trudeau, among others.
Then the leaders mounted the state for a group photo.
POTUS, in a red tie, stood next to Duterte, in traditional white Philippine shirt.

Give is your brightest smile, the MC intoned as cameras flashed. Then he instructed them to give each other the customary ASEAN handshake, right hand over left hand.
After a false start, Trump executed the handshake correctly and smiled much more enthusiastically than he had for the photo.
The leaders sat down and listened to the playing of various ASEAN songs, which celebrated the soaring spirit of this group and had the vague echo of a Disney musical.
Rodrigo Duterte then took the lectern to martial music.
He opened by noting the Philippines success is defeating ISIS-linked extremists and thanked foreign partners for their help.
I apologize for setting the tone of statement in such a manner, he said, but added these threats know no boundaries.
The menace of the illegal drug trade continues to threaten the fabric of our societies, Duterte said, making no mention of his controversial anti-drug campaign.
He announced that ASEAN leaders had reached an agreement on the rights of migrant workers.
Then he declared the summit formally open.

After Duterte took his seat again, Trump leaned over and patted him lightly on the knee.

At that point, young dancers took the stage, performing a traditional dance under the slogan connected. Lots of whooping, percussion, and a Pacific Island theme (think, the movie Moana.)
Next came the tale of Rama Hari, with dancers from the Philippine ballet. Rama and Siri each sing of their frustrated love. The kingdom then celebrates Ramas victory over evil forces (lots of running around with large orange flags).
Next came a tribute to youth culture with dancers doing a kind of slow-motion hip hop.
As the thumping beat went on, pool returned to the motorcade for the ride back to the Sofitel and wthe first of Trumps bilateral meetings, with Malcom Turnbull of Australia.
